Blog ini akan menerangkan penggunaan 'const' dengan objek dalam JavaScript.
Penggunaan 'const' Dengan Objek dalam JavaScript
' const ” dengan objek dalam JavaScript membenarkan pengubahsuaian sifat objek tetapi tidak membenarkan penugasan semula pembolehubah kepada objek lain.
Contoh
Cipta atau isytiharkan objek bernama “ obj ' menggunakan ' const ' kata kunci dengan tiga atribut ' nama ”, “ umur ”, dan “ hobi ”:
const obj = {
nama : 'Mili' ,
umur : 24 ,
hobi : 'Membaca Buku'
}
Akses nilai atribut objek ' hobi 'menggunakan titik' . ” operator dan cetak pada konsol dengan bantuan “ console.log() ' kaedah:
konsol. log ( obj. hobi ) ;
Output menunjukkan bahawa kami telah berjaya mengakses nilai ' const ” harta benda bernama “ hobi ”:
Di sini, kami akan mengubah suai nilai ' const ” harta benda bernama “ hobi ” kepada “ Melukis ” dan cetak pada konsol:
obj. hobi = 'Lukisan' ;
konsol. log ( obj. hobi ) ;
Nilai telah berjaya dikemas kini. Ia menunjukkan bahawa sifat objek const boleh dikemas kini dengan mudah:
Tetapi 'const' tidak akan membenarkan penugasan semula pembolehubah ke objek lain. Di sini, kami akan menetapkan objek baharu kepada objek 'const' ' obj ”:
obj = {nama : 'Emma' ,
umur : 26 ,
hobi : 'Melancong'
}
Cetak 'obj' sebagai objek yang dikemas kini:
konsol. log ( obj ) ;Pengeluaran
Itu sahaja tentang penggunaan 'const' dengan objek dalam JavaScript.
Kesimpulan
Pembolehubah dengan ' const ' kata kunci dalam JavaScript tidak boleh diubah tetapi objek dengan ' const ” tidak boleh diubah, anda masih boleh mengubah suai sifatnya. Walau bagaimanapun, const tidak membenarkan penugasan semula pembolehubah ke objek lain. Blog ini menerangkan penggunaan 'const' dengan objek dalam JavaScript.